RGB, HSL and CMYK Values
RGB
144, 96, 108
Red: 144 / Green: 96 / Blue: 108
HSL
345°, 20%, 47%
Hue: 345° / Saturation: 20% / Lightness: 47%
CMYK
0%, 33%, 25%, 44%
Cyan: 0% / Magenta: 33% / Yellow: 25% / Key: 44%
